Philadelphia: Charles j. Peterson, 1877. Soft cover. Good. Peterson's Ladies National Magazine. February Vol. LXXI, No. 2. Philadelphia, 1877. Pages 109-172, plus fashion prints, engravings, advertisements. 1 fold-out color plate: Les Modes Parisiennes, The Winter Promenade, Engraved and printed by Illman Brothers; engraving "Such a Love of a Man" painted by E. Boutibonne, Illman Brothers engravers, for the story of the same name on page 109-11 by the Author of 'The Story of an Umbrella." Foldout of design for straw embroidery on net; other fashion prints of the period and handiwork patterns. Stories included: Frances Hodgson Burnett, "The Captain's Youngest;" "Rhoda's Prisoner" by Rosalie Gray [Mrs. D. H. Mann]; "That Female Lect'rer and I" by Josiah Allen's Wife [pen name of Marietta Holley [1836-1926]; and many others. Condition is GOOD with edgewear all around, small tears and chipping, owner name on front cover["Azuba C Dennis" ] - internally all is very good with only edges chipped. Nice for the Burnett story and the color fashion print.
